Commercial Aerospace Network
• Flight deck (HUD, display) graphics generators and receivers;
• Core systems, sensors, and cameras;
• In-Flight Entertainment and crew cabin interfaces;
Fiber Networking Advantages:
• Reduces EMI problems in
aircraft with composite shells;
• Reduces data wire weight by up
to 70%;
• Increase network bandwidth
and enable multiple protocols;
• Enables distributed network
architectures.

Product Families
• RCP: Innovative multi-channel, 1-10Gbps rugged pluggable;
• RJ: Miniature 1-10Gbps surface/screw mount diagnostics;
• SFF: Rugged industry standard 1-4Gbps thru-hole, with dual channels;
• LAC: Active cables for inside of LRU with discrete Tx/Rx;
• DSUB: Rugged 1-4Gbps thru-hole, with dual channels;
• Custom Mil/Aero fiber optic cabling and transceiver pigtails including
COTSWORKS’ unique rugged termini;
• Rugged media conversion, test products and integration.

Conformal Coatings
• Coatings seal components on boards including OSAs against moisture/corrosion;
• Parylene vacuum deposition process creates even thickness on all surfaces and
prevents uneven thermal expansion.
Attribute Parylene C
Mil-I-46058C IPC-CC-830B Yes
Cost Expensive
Colors Available Clear
Application CVD
Resistance to Acids Excellent
Resistance to Bases Excellent
Resistance to Solvents Excellent
Cure Type CVD
Shelf Life of raw material (months) 12
Operating Temp. Range ℃ -195 to +125
UV Additive Yes
Dielectric Strength 6900 V/Mil
Dielectric Constant 3.10
Dielectric Factor 0.0027
Ease of Rework Hard
Solubility N/A

Rugged Demo: Ice to Boiling Water
• Conformal coated PCBs resist corrosion that occurs with fine
pitch components, mitigates tin whisker growth, and prevents
blistering or flaking of PCB layers;
• Provides an insulating layer for ESD or other electrical input;
• Environmental protection.
